Provided is an active energy beam-curable water-based resin composition which is obtained by reaction of an acrylic resin (A) obtained by copolymerizing essential starting materials, namely an acrylic monomer (a1) including a polyoxyalkylene group, an acrylic monomer (a2) including a hydroxyl group, and an acrylic monomer (a3) other than the acrylic monomer (a1) and the acrylic monomer (a2); a polyisocyanate compound (B); and (meth)acrylate (C) having a hydroxyl group, followed by dispersion of the reaction product in an aqueous medium. The active energy beam-curable water-based resin composition has excellent storage stability, provides a good appearance of the cured coating film thereof, and exhibits high adhesion with a substrate even after immersion in hot water, and the composition is thus suitable for use in an active energy beam-curable water-based coating. |
